Mobile APSO’s ‘56 Days of Blessing’ helps Alabama community this spring By Donna Cope April 27, 2021 Alabama Power Customer Service Representative Vivian Ballard put her fishing skills to good use through the 56 Days of Blessing project sponsored by the Mobile Chapter of the Alabama Power Service Organization (APSO), allowing her to give a nice donation in support of Mobile nonprofit groups. Numerous employees sacrificed some of their favorite indulgences to give to Mobile APSO, helping raise nearly $2,000 to help the less fortunate in their community. (Vivian Ballard / Alabama Power) A café latte here, a candy bar there and it’s not long before you’ve spent a chunk of change.

Mobile emergency center McKemie Place hosts ribbon cutting Updated Dec 10, 2020; A Mobile emergency center for women held a ribbon cutting last Friday for their new location, which will help the organization continue to help out women in need. Mobile Mayor Sandy Stimpson posted about the ribbon cutting for McKemie Place on his Facebook page, praising the organization for helping out the community. On Friday, I was honored to help cut the ribbon at a new location for McKemie Place, which is the only emergency.Posted by Sandy Stimpson on Monday, December 7, 2020 McKemie Place first opened back in March of 2007 as the only emergency overnight shelter for unaccompanied women in Southwest Alabama. This is still the case more than 10 years later.
